An RAF Spitfire fighter plane after being refurbished by British Aerospace apprentices and staff after it had stood for years as a gate guard at RAF Bawdry in Wales.
The Spitfire PS915 was handed over to the RAF in full flying operational condition after three years work on the machine.
Pictured are two of the fitters ridingm on the tailplane of the aircraft on its way up too the runway for take off. The plane is nise-heavy and needs " ballast" to keep the tail-plane down as it taxis.
